Unexpunged
verb (used with object), expunged, expunging.
1.
to strike or blot out; erase; obliterate.
2.
to efface; wipe out or destroy.
verb (transitive)
1.
to delete or erase; blot out; obliterate
2.
to wipe out or destroy
